Scotti Renee Jackson

Jan 08 1996 - Aug 13 2015

Scotti Renee Jackson formerly of Allen, Texas passed away August 13, 2015 at the age of 19. She was born January 8, 1996 to Scott Force Jackson and Kimberly Renee (Rushin) Jackson in Plano Texas. Scotti was a 2014 graduate of Allen High School. She was a member of First United Methodist Church in Allen and the Allen area Young Life. Scotti was a loved and cherished daughter, sister, granddaughter, cousin, aunt and friend. She was sweet, smart, caring, playful, spontaneous and outgoing. She had a gorgeous smile that would light up a room. She was beautiful inside and out and brought joy to many.

Scotti is survived by her parents, Scott and Kim Jackson of Celina, Texas; siblings, Bronwyn Marie Foster and significant other, Phillip Parks of Euless, Texas, Scott Heath Jackson and wife Megan of Forney, Texas, Candice Lindsey Whitton and husband Billy of Nevada, Texas, and Casey Garrett Jackson of Celina, Texas; grandparents, Richard and Karen Lee of Dallas, Texas; uncles, Kevin Rushin of Dallas, Texas, David Jackson, and significant other Kate Morrow of Dallas, Texas, Dan Jackson and wife Deana of Dripping Springs, Texas; aunt, Stephanie Baird and husband Reggie of Midlothian, Texas; nieces and nephews, Cody Foster, Katelyn Jackson, Rylie Whitton, and Kindal Jackson.

She was preceded in death by her grandparents, Bonnie and O.T. Rushin, Robert and Odessa Treese and Wendal Jackson.

A funeral service will be held 2:00 p.m., Tuesday, August 18, 2015 at Turrentine-Jackson-Morrow Funeral Home Chapel in Allen, Texas. Interment will follow at Old Celina Cemetery in Celina, Texas. The family will receive friends during a visitation on Monday evening from 7:00 p.m. to 9:00 p.m. at the funeral home.
